Second Team Tied With Andover

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

The University second football eleven played a tie game with Phillips Andover Academy at Andover Saturday afternoon, neither team being able to score. Andover was twice dangerously near Harvard's goal, but was held for downs the first time, and later lost the ball on a fumble. The second team was better, than its opponents on the defence, Rand and Moore doing especially good work.
